Wine Advocate

The 2013 Seven Flags Pinot Noir is the seventh vintage and comes from the oldest vines from 113 Dijon clone, from the top left hand corner of the 4.5-hectare vineyard, and this represents a barrel selection. It has a refined, laid back bouquet with a pleasing earthiness, the 50% whole bunch lending freshness here. The palate is medium-bodied with supple tannin, more red than black fruit with raspberry preserve and cranberry leaf, a touch of bergamot towards the finish. Perhaps not as long term as other vintages, but still just a delicious Pinot Noir whose easy-drinking qualities are a virtue.
